The Mayor of Aba North Local Government Area, Hon. Timothy Kalu Iheke, alongside members of the Aba North Legislative Council, paid a condolence visit to the family of the late Chief Dr. Eme Abali Mba, whose death reportedly came as a shock to the leadership and staff of the Council.
The condolence visit, which took place on Wednesday, September 2, 2026, saw the Mayor and members of the legislative council visit the deceased’s family to commiserate with them and offer their support during the difficult period of mourning.
Speaking during the visit, Mayor Iheke expressed sympathy to the family and acknowledged the loss of the late political leader and community stakeholder. He assured the family that the Aba North Local Government Council would continue to stand by them and provide necessary support whenever required.
Responding, the widow of the deceased, Mrs. Ijeoma Abali Mba, expressed appreciation to Mayor Iheke and the councillors for taking the time to visit the family and identify with them in their moment of grief. She also appealed to the delegation to continue remembering the family in their prayers.
Late Chief Dr. Eme Abali Mba was a prominent political and community stakeholder from the Ukwa extraction of the Ukwa/Ngwa socio-political bloc. He was widely associated with advocacy for regional equity and fair political representation, particularly regarding the rotation of the Abia South Senatorial seat between the Ngwa and Ukwa sub-groups.
His political activities also extended to the Peoples Democratic Party, PDP, where he was recognised for his advocacy for the political interests and representation of the Ukwa people.
Ahead of the 2019 general elections, he served as the Director-General of the Solomon Ogunji Campaign Organization and championed the call for the recognition of the Ukwa people’s rotation rights in the Abia South Senatorial District.
Chief Abali Mba also had a notable history in local government administration, having served as Chairman of Aba North Local Government Area from 1999 to 2023.
